先存钱还是先投资?
伍治坚证据主义· 2025-08-18 06:44
Core Viewpoint - The article emphasizes the importance of having an emergency fund and prudent financial planning as foundational elements for long-term wealth accumulation, rather than chasing high-risk investments or trends [2][3][7]. Group 1: Emergency Fund Importance - Establishing an emergency fund of three to six months' living expenses is crucial for financial stability, as highlighted by financial expert Dave Ramsey [3]. - Research indicates that having an emergency fund significantly enhances financial well-being, with those having $2,000 in savings experiencing a 21% increase in financial happiness [3]. - Individuals with less than $5,000 in emergency savings are 52% more likely to suffer from depression compared to those with over $5,000 [3]. Group 2: Wealth Accumulation Strategies - True wealth accumulation often involves low-key lifestyles, as evidenced by data showing that many millionaires drive modest cars like Toyota and Honda rather than luxury brands [4]. - Wealthy individuals prioritize investments that appreciate in value rather than spending on superficial items, akin to a farmer focusing resources on essential crops rather than ornamental plants [5]. - High investment management fees can erode returns, making it essential for investors to choose low-cost index funds and ETFs [5][6]. Group 3: Understanding Expenses and Financial Behavior - Many individuals underestimate their fixed expenses, such as home maintenance and insurance, which can exceed 1% of their home value annually [6]. - Behavioral economics suggests that having an emergency fund allows individuals to remain calm during market fluctuations, while those without such a buffer may make impulsive decisions driven by fear or greed [6]. - A significant portion of the global population has low net worth, with over 80% having less than $100,000 in net assets, underscoring the importance of consistent saving and spending control [6]. Group 4: Long-term Financial Planning - The article argues that while macroeconomic conditions are unpredictable, individuals can control their financial preparedness and investment education [7]. - The philosophy of prudent financial management is echoed in historical teachings, emphasizing moderation and rational planning as keys to happiness and financial success [7][8]. - Building a solid financial foundation through savings and disciplined investment is essential before pursuing high-risk opportunities [8].

What is a no-spend challenge, and is it right for you?
Yahoo Finance· 2024-06-25 15:07
Core Concept - The no-spend challenge is a commitment to refrain from nonessential purchases for a specified period, helping individuals to manage spending habits and reset financial priorities [2][11] Group 1: Definition and Purpose - A no-spend challenge allows essential purchases like groceries and bills but restricts discretionary spending such as dining out and entertainment [2] - Participants can save money and identify overspending areas in their budget, leading to informed financial adjustments [3] Group 2: Steps to Participate - Defining financial goals is crucial, whether to increase cash flow or curb impulse spending, and writing them down can enhance motivation [5] - Setting a timeline for the challenge can vary from a few days to a year, depending on individual preferences [6] - Establishing ground rules for spending during the challenge is essential, including a list of approved expenses and potential flexibility for unforeseen costs [8][9] Group 3: Financial Strategies During the Challenge - Building or adding to an emergency fund is recommended, with even a small fund of $250 potentially reducing the risk of eviction or missed bills [7] - Utilizing a high-yield savings account can maximize savings, with current rates reaching up to 4% APY [7] - Paying down high-interest debt, particularly credit card balances, is advisable with the savings accrued during the challenge [7] - Treating oneself occasionally is acceptable, provided it fits within the budget without incurring new debt [7] Group 4: Considerations for the Challenge - A no-spend challenge is not a long-term financial strategy but can serve as a short-term tool to save money and reassess spending habits [11] - Essential monthly bills, groceries, gas, and necessary personal items are typically allowed, while dining out, entertainment, and luxury services are restricted [12]
